Local Guidelines for Dumpster Use
Fort Worth, TX, has established rules regarding the placement and use of dumpsters to maintain safety, accessibility, and environmental standards. Property owners and contractors are required to adhere to city codes related to the positioning of dumpsters on public streets, sidewalks, and private properties. Breaking the rules may lead to penalties or confiscation of the dumpster. All our rentals comply with local rules, and we assist with necessary approvals before placement.
Local rules may differ between neighborhoods and depend on traffic or zoning requirements. Dumpsters positioned on public roads often need special permits from city authorities. Materials You Cannot Place in a Dumpster
There are specific restrictions on dumpster contents, and Fort Worth regulations enforce these for public health and environmental safety. Items such as hazardous chemicals, certain electronics, and flammable materials cannot be placed in standard dumpsters. Violating these restrictions can lead to fines, environmental liability, or additional disposal costs. We provide guidance on which materials are allowed and which are not.
Correctly sorting waste is a key part of staying compliant. Fort Worth regulations may require different handling for debris, yard clippings, and household garbage.
